Asbestos is a mineral that occurs naturally is utilized in the manufacture of products for insulation and fire retardants. Inhaling the fibers could cause inflammation and fibrosis, which scar the lung tissue with time. Symptoms of mesothelioma may not appear for decades after exposure, making it difficult to recognize the disease.

The symptoms of mesothelioma could manifest as chest discomfort that ranges from sharp to dull or as a feeling of pressure on the chest. It may also trigger fluid retention in the lining of the heart, which is known as pericardial effusion. Patients with mesothelioma may also experience a chronic cough and reduced breathing.

Lawyers are compensated for their time and also the time of their assistants. This includes attending court hearings, writing and researching documents, defending and taking a deposition and preparing for a trial, and presenting evidence during the trial. In certain types of cases, lawyers are paid by the hour. In most mesothelioma cases, however, lawyers are paid on the basis of a contingent fee.
